Understanding the Role of Asphalt Plants in Modern Construction
An asphalt plant is an industrial facility designed to produce asphalt concrete by combining various materials—including asphalt binder, aggregates, and fillers—in precise proportions. These plants are pivotal in ensuring the consistent quality, availability, and sustainability of asphalt used across a multitude of applications.
From road construction to paving private parking lots, the importance of asphalt plants cannot be overstated. They enable large-scale projects to meet strict specifications, adhere to safety standards, and optimize costs, all while maintaining environmental responsibilities.
Types of Asphalt Plants: Tailoring Solutions for Diverse Construction Needs
1. Drum Mix Asphalt Plants
Drum mix asphalt plants are classified as continuous plants, where materials are mixed in a rotary drum. Their primary advantage is high production capacity, making them ideal for large-scale projects. They operate with a straightforward process, producing asphalt continuously without interruption, which enhances efficiency.
2. Batch Mix Asphalt Plants
Batch mix asphalt plants produce asphalt in specific batches, offering excellent control over mixture proportions and quality. They are preferred for projects requiring varying mix designs, such as complex urban construction or specialty pavements. The batch process involves precise weighing, mixing, and quality control, ensuring top-tier asphalt consistency.
3. Mobile and Stationary Asphalt Plants
- Mobile asphalt plants: Designed for flexibility, enabling quick relocation and deployment at various sites. They are perfect for projects with limited or changing locations.
- Stationary asphalt plants: Fixed in one location, suitable for long-term projects and continuous production needs, offering higher capacity and greater operational stability.
Advanced Technologies Powering Modern Asphalt Plants
The evolution of asphalt plant technology has revolutionized the construction industry by improving productivity, environmental compliance, and product quality. Modern plants incorporate:
- Recycling capabilities: Use of warm mix and RAP (Reclaimed Asphalt Pavement) to promote sustainability and reduce costs.
- Automation and control systems: PLC (Programmable Logic Controller) based systems for real-time monitoring, automatic adjustments, and remote operation.
- Environmental controls: Dust collection systems, emission filters, and noise reduction technology to minimize environmental impact.
- Energy efficiency: Insulation, energy recuperators, and variable speed drives to optimize power consumption.

Industry Trends Shaping the Future of Asphalt Plants
1. Sustainable Development and Green Technologies
Environmental consciousness is influencing asphalt plant design, with a focus on reducing carbon footprints, utilizing RAP, and adopting warm mix asphalt technology that consumes less energy and produces fewer emissions.
2. Digitalization and Smart Plants
Integrating IoT (Internet of Things) enables smarter operations, predictive maintenance, and enhanced quality control, leading to minimized downtime and increased efficiency.
3. Modular and Compact Designs
Such innovations allow faster setup, easier transportation, and adaptability to a wide range of project sizes, which is especially beneficial for remote or small-scale projects.
